首页
学习
活动
专区
圈层
工具
发布
    • 综合排序
    • 最热优先
    • 最新优先
    时间不限
  • Vue AI组件推荐:一个开箱即用的 Vue3 AI 聊天组件,帮你快速完成 Vue 接入 AI

    如果你最近正在找一款适合业务落地的VueAI组件,或者正在研究Vue接入AI组件Vue接入AI到底怎么做更省时间,那这篇文章你可以重点看一下。 我觉得这个组件值得推荐的几个核心原因1.Vue接入AI足够快,基础接入门槛低这一点很重要。很多开发者搜“vue接入ai”的时候,其实最关心的就是:能不能少写点胶水代码,先跑起来。 意味着你在做Vue接入AI组件时,不必为了前端容器再去重写一套聊天交互层,尤其适合已经有AI服务但还没完善前端体验的团队。 一个总结:这不是“能不能用”的问题,而是“值不值得作为业务AI入口”如果只问一句:这个组件值不值得推荐?我的答案是:值得,而且比较适合希望快速完成Vue接入AI组件的团队。 对于正在搜索这些关键词的同学:vueai组件vue接入ai组件vue接入aivue3ai聊天组件ai聊天组件vueai助手组件我觉得这会是一个可以认真评估的方案。

    7720编辑于 2026-06-05
  • Vue接入AI聊天助手实战

    经过一番调研,我发现了一个非常优秀的Vue组件ai-suspended-ball-chat。这个组件不仅功能丰富,而且集成简单,完美解决了我的需求。今天就来分享一下我的实战经验。为什么选择这个组件? 功能全面,开箱即用这个组件提供了丰富的功能特性: AI对话:支持与AI进行自然语言对话 双模式请求:支持普通请求和流式响应两种模式️ 图片上传:支持图片上传和AI图像识别 语音输入:支持语音转文字输入 技术先进,性能优秀支持Vue 3 Composition API完整的TypeScript类型定义支持流式响应,实时显示AI回复响应式设计,适配各种屏幕尺寸快速开始安装组件npm install ai-suspended-ball-chat 是一个功能强大、易于集成的Vue AI聊天组件。 聊天组件,我强烈推荐试试这个组件

    53910编辑于 2025-09-27
  • 来自专栏灵墨AI探索室

    深入解析 Spring AI 系列:剖析OpenAI接口接入组件

    今天我们将继续探讨如何在Spring AI接入大语言模型,以OpenAI为例,详细分析其接入过程。 通过这张图,你可以清晰地看到各个组件之间的关系,以及数据如何在各个模块中流动和交互。 聊天对接我们目前主要关注的是聊天接口是如何接入的,至于其他功能,如音频或图像处理,我们可以在后续的讨论中再进行详细探讨。 为了快速了解 Spring AI 如何实现这个链路的传递,我们可以简要地浏览一下非常简单的用法:@GetMapping("/ai-Entity")ActorFilms generationByEntity 总结通过今天的分析,我们对如何在Spring AI框架中接入OpenAI的大语言模型有了更清晰的了解。从配置接口到封装参数,再到定义相关接口,我们逐步剖析了整个接入过程。

    81520编辑于 2025-01-07
  • 来自专栏全栈程序员必看

    VUE组件封装_vue使用组件

    Vue组件化思想 组件化是Vue中的重要思想,当我们对vue的基本知识有了一定的基础就要开始封装组件了 它提供了一种抽象,让我们可以开发出一个个独立可复用的小组件来构造我们的应用。组件树。 的 .vue 单文件组件来写。 注册组件 分为 局部注册 与 全局注册,下一章再讲 ......使用代码......... import cInput from "组件地址/c-ipunt.vue"; export default from "组件地址/c-ipunt.vue"; export default { components: {cInput}, ....... </script> 二.丰富组件 组件是独立的作用域,就像我们 Node 中的 JavaScript 模块一样,独立的 组件其实就是一个特殊的 Vue 实例,可以有自己的 data、methods

    2.5K40编辑于 2022-11-09
  • 来自专栏鲸鱼动画

    Vue组件基础--简单了解vue组件

    Vue组件基础–简单了解vue组件 Vue组件是什么? 组件就像是提前做好的模具,使用时拿出来就行,可以重复调用,它跟普通的Vue有一样的属性: data (数据存放) computed(计算属性) watch(监听属性) methods(方法存放) -- 使用v-bind(:)动态传递prop --> </my-p>

    Vue.component('my-p',{ props:['title'], //props向子组件传递数据
    ` //子组件通过 $emit 方法并传入事件名触发事件 //$emit可以使用第二个参数向上抛值,监听的父组件通过$event获取 }) new Vue({ el: -- 组件中v-model的使用 --> <my-input v-model="myText"></my-input>

    {{myText}}

    Vue.component(

1.8K20发布于 2020-09-21
  • 来自专栏全栈程序员必看

    vue常用组件库_vue内置组件

    封装 vue-material-design:Vue MD风格组件 vue-morris:Vuejs组件封装Morrisjs库 we-vueVue2及weui1开发的组件 vue-image-clip vue-cmap:Vue China map可视化组件 vue-button:Vue按钮组件 二、Vue.js开发框架 vue.js:流行的轻量高效的前端组件化方案 vue-admin:Vue管理面板框架 :vue的Bootstrap样式组件 vuep:用实时编辑和预览来渲染Vue组件 vue-online:reactive的在线和离线组件 vue-lazy-render:用于Vue组件的延迟渲染 – 易于使用的滑块组件 vue-images – 显示一组图片的lightbox组件 vue-carousel-3d – VueJS的3D轮播组件 vue-slide – vue轻量级滑动组件 vue-slider – vue 滑动组件 vue-m-carousel – vue 移动端轮播组件 dd-vue-component – 订单来了的公共组件vue-easy-slider

    10.8K20编辑于 2022-11-15
  • 来自专栏sktj

    vue 组件

    image.png props image.png props传递参数 image.png

    1.2K10发布于 2019-08-28
  • 来自专栏火属性小虫

    Vue组件

    , 13 8月 2021 作者 847954981@qq.com 前端学习 Vue组件 组件就是可复用的Vue实例,在开发过程中,我们可以把重复使用的功能封装成自定义组件,以达到便捷开发的目的。 为了能在模板 <template> 中使用,这些组件必须先注册以便 Vue能够识别。 组件的注册 在 Vue 中,组件的注册分全局注册和局部注册两种: 全局注册:用 Vue.component 来创建组件,注册之后可以在任何新创建的 Vue 根实例中使用; 局部注册:在单个 Vue 格式的文件中创建组件 组件的创建 每个Vue格式的文件都可以作为一个组件来使用 组件的局部注册 首先我们需要创建一个Vue文件 然后需要定义组件名字 图片 在需要使用的地方,注册组件、引入组件以及使用组件 组件内数据 这种情况,如果我们需要父组件事件一起触发,可以添加 Vue 修饰符 修饰符使用点开头的指令后缀表示的 如 .prevent 和 .capture 而要让父组件内容被执行,我们需要添加 .native 修饰符

    1.5K30编辑于 2023-02-22
  • 来自专栏全栈学习专栏

    Vue系列---Vue组件

    讲解 Spring系列 Spring Boot 系列 云原生系列(付费专栏) 今天叶秋学长带领大家继续学习vue讲解系列专栏中的Vue组件~~ 一、为什么需要组件? 一个页面逻辑很多,放在一起不利于管理,不利于开发,将一个页面分割成小小的功能块 vue组件化 应用:任何应用都是一颗组件树 1.创建组件 const cpn = Vue.extend({}):创建一个组件构造器 template:表示我们组件的模板(其实就是你要显示的html) Vue.component('组件名称',构造器cpn) 使用:<组件名称></组件名称> 编辑 2.创建组件语法糖写法 vue都可以使用 局部组件 挂载在某一个vue实例下,其他组件不可以用 4.父组件和子组件 简单理解,在谁的div里面去使用的组件,就是这个对应的子组件

    components:{ son:{ template:`

    组件

    ` } } }); new Vue({ el

    1K20编辑于 2022-08-14
  • 来自专栏生如夏花绚烂

    Vue组件

    局部组件 只能在当前vm对象中使用 定义方法 import Vue from 'vue/dist/vue.esm'; import VueRouter from 'vue-router'; let 可在任意地方调用 定义方法 //组件 cmp1.js import Vue from 'vue/dist/vue.esm'; export default Vue.component('cmp1', />

    ` }) 组件传参 //vm.js import Vue from 'vue/dist/vue.esm'; import VueRouter from 'vue-router'; 根据不同类型显示不同组件 通过<component is></component>设置要显示的组件 import Vue from 'vue/dist/vue.esm'; import VueRouter 此时显示的是a.vue组件内部的值

    98320编辑于 2022-09-08
  • 来自专栏生如夏花绚烂

    Vue组件

    概述 组件:拆分vue实例代码量,不同的组件来划分不同的功能模块,需要什么功能调用什么组件 组件化与模块化的不同: 1.模块化是从代码逻辑的角度进行划分,方便代码分层开发,保证每个功能模块职能单一。 2.组件化是从ui界面的角度划分 定义组件 全局组件 语法格式 第一种 Vue.component('组件名称',{ template:"

    "//组件html结构 }) 第二种 //app操作区域外定义组件html <template id="cmp1">
    </template> Vue.component('组件名称',{ template > Vue.component('login',{ template:"
    登录组件
    " }) var vm = } } }) 如果切换的组件较多,用这种方式就不能满足需求,我们可以通过vue提供的<component :is="<em>组件</em>变量">

    86710编辑于 2022-09-08
  • 来自专栏全栈程序员必看

    VUE组件封装_vue组件内部双向绑定

    props中value属性,子组件修改value值需要通过触发input事件并传递需要修改的值给父组件。 简单的效果: 父组件Home.vue: <template>

    <button @click="isShow=true">修改</button isShow" title="修改昵称"></child>
    </template> <script> import child from '@/components/child.vue Child.vue: <template>
    如果想修改v-model绑定子组件的props属性值,那么可以修改子组件model中的prop为需要设置的props中的某个值。 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。

    1.2K10编辑于 2022-11-09
  • 来自专栏全栈程序员必看

    vue弹窗组件封装_vue弹出框组件

    创建一个toast.js文件,(图片随便找的,改一下即可) import { Toast } from 'vant'; Vue.use(Toast); Toast.setDefaultOptions({ message: msg, icon: imgUrl, className: 'myshowToast' }); } // 挂载 import Vue from 'vue'; Vue.prototype. $mytoast = new Vue() Vue.prototype.

    1.2K00编辑于 2022-09-30
  • 来自专栏全栈程序员必看

    vue封装组件方法_什么是vue组件

    如: “vue_common”: “file:…/vue_common_name”, “vue_common_git”: “git+https://gitee.com/XXXXX/vue_common.git #master”, 2、link引用: 首先在组件文件下的控制台输入npm link ; 然后在项目控制台下输入 npm link XX组件文件名。 这时修改组件项目下面的任意代码都会实时生效,不用打包,也不用重启了。在package.json中没有引入记录。 3、npm package(目前两种:a、不打包可以有多个组件, b、打包的话只能有一个组件?)

    83150编辑于 2022-11-09
  • 来自专栏程序小小事

    这可能是 Vue 接入百度地图的最佳组件

    最近负责的一个Vue项目中需要调用百度地图API做定位、检索等需求。按照百度地图官方 API 的接入文档,很多功能需要需要改造、封装,实在太繁琐了。 经过查阅对比,最后发现了Vue Baidu Map这个好用的组件。 图片Vue Baidu Map简介Vue Baidu Map 是一个基于 Vue.js 封装的百度地图组件,几乎包含百度地图官方所有的 API 示例,同时也支持引入百度地图扩展包。 图片图片使用这里展示在Vue项目中的使用安装NPM加载依赖$ npm install vue-baidu-map --save注册全局注册:一次性引入百度地图组件库的所有组件。 再也不用去看难懂的百度地图官方 API 文档了,可以接入引入组件到自己的 Vue 项目中去。

    63700编辑于 2023-07-20
  • 来自专栏前端实验室

    这可能是 Vue 接入百度地图的最佳组件了!

    最近负责的一个Vue项目中需要调用百度地图API做定位、检索等需求。 按照百度地图官方 API 的接入文档,很多功能需要需要改造、封装,实在太繁琐了。 经过查阅对比,最后发现了Vue Baidu Map这个好用的组件Vue Baidu Map简介 Vue Baidu Map 是一个基于 Vue.js 封装的百度地图组件,几乎包含百度地图官方所有的 API 示例,同时也支持引入百度地图扩展包。 使用 这里展示在 Vue 项目中的使用。 安装 NPM加载依赖 $ npm install vue-baidu-map --save 注册 全局注册:一次性引入百度地图组件库的所有组件。 再也不用去看难懂的百度地图官方 API 文档了,可以接入引入组件到自己的 Vue 项目中去。 顺便一提一下...

    93440编辑于 2022-12-02
  • 来自专栏前端之旅

    Vue 组件(四):组件插槽

    image.png 1.组件组件实际上是可以复用的 Vue 实例,它们与 new Vue 接收相同的选项,例如 data、computed、methods 以及生命周期钩子等。 何谓复用? 全局组件 全局组件在 new Vue 之前创建,创建之后可用于所有根实例的模板中。 2.x 之前全局组件的创建过程如下: let obj = Vue.extend({/*option*/}) // 创建组件构造器对象 Vue.component(TagName,obj) // 注册组件 2.x 之后语法糖的写法如下: Vue.component("TagName",{/*option*/}) // 同时创建并注册组件 2.2 局部组件 更多的是创建局部组件,让其只能在当前所处的 Vue 实例的模板中使用。

    1.3K40发布于 2019-11-08
  • 来自专栏全栈程序员必看

    vue组件调用父组件函数_vue组件修改父组件

    直接在子组件中通过this. $parent.event来调用父组件的方法 父组件: <template>

    <child></child>
    </template> <script> import methods: { fatherMethod() { console.log('测试'); } } }; </script> 子组件 在子组件里用$emit向父组件触发一个事件,父组件监听这个事件 父组件: <template>
    <child @fMethod="fatherMethod"></child> 父组件把方法传入子组件中,在子组件里直接调用 父组件: <template>
    <child :fatherMethod="fatherMethod"></child> </div

    2.7K20编辑于 2022-11-10
  • 来自专栏Super 前端

    Vue基础:组件--组件组件通信

    组件 组件可以扩展 HTML 元素,封装可重用的代码。在较高层面上,组件是自定义元素,Vue.js 的编译器为它添加特殊功能。在有些情况下,组件也可以是原生 HTML 元素的形式,以is特性扩展。 使用组件 注册一个全局组件,你可以使用 Vue.component(tagName, [definition]) // 注册组件,传入一个扩展过的构造器 Vue.component('my-component ', Vue.extend({ /* ... */ })) // 注册组件,传入一个选项对象 (自动调用 Vue.extend) Vue.component('my-component', { /* . .. */ }) // 获取注册的组件 (始终返回构造器) var MyComponent = Vue.component('my-component') 使用组件实例选项注册局部组件 new Vue 非父子组件的通信如果情况简单,可以使用全局event bus var bus = new Vue();复杂的情况下往往用vuex。

    2.4K31发布于 2019-08-15
  • 来自专栏站长的编程笔记

    Vue组件之动态组件

    动态组件:不同组件之间进行动态切换,通过 Vue 的 元素加一个特殊的 is attribute 实现 1. 基础使用 ---- component 的 is 属性值是组件名,就可以调用该组件 <component is="comb"></component>

    <component var coma = { template: '
    aaaa
    ' } var comb = { template: '
    bbbb
    ' } let vm = new Vue 动态调用组件示例 ----
    <button @click="changeComponent('coma')">coma</button> <button @click="changeComponent var comb = { template: '<div>bbbb</div>' } var comc = { template: '<div>cccc</div>' } let vm = new <em>Vue</em>

    1.4K30编辑于 2023-02-17
  • 第 2 页第 3 页第 4 页第 5 页第 6 页第 7 页第 8 页第 9 页第 10 页第 11 页
    点击加载更多
    领券